Presumably that's something they posted themselves, at least, but I'm increasingly not convinced.
Their linkedin page claims they're in Ontario. Their website has, in the past, claimed they're in Ontario (not a specific city in Ontario, just Ontario generally), Dubai, Newbury Park, CA, Arcadia and Simi Valley, CA, Irvine, CA, and another address in Irvine, CA. Many of these are residential addresses; the last one is an office building that exists explicitly so that companies without offices can pretend to have offices for public image reasons.
The current source, for whatever reliability it has, lists employees in both Hyderabad (software developers) and the US (editorial staff).
From this, I think what's actually going on is that the owner does in fact live in the US (and used to live in Canada), these are their past home addresses, the business is registered in the US (search for 3853331 at [2]), and they outsource their software development to Hyderabad (and may or may not have a legal entity there).
